Choosing the Right Hamper: Quality and Presentation

The success of a gourmet hamper hinges on two pillars: the quality of the contents and the visual appeal.

Quality Matters

    Source Authenticity: Ensure truffles come from reputable farms in Piedmont, Alba, or Oregon. Complementary Pairings: Include items that highlight the truffle’s flavor—artisan bread, aged butter, and a glass of fine wine. Freshness Guarantees: Look for hampers that promise freshness or offer a “freshness guarantee” sticker.

Presentation Wins Hearts

    Elegant Packaging: A sturdy, recyclable box with a matte finish exudes sophistication. Personalized Touches: Add a custom label or a handwritten note. Visual Hierarchy: Arrange items so the truffle is the centerpiece, surrounded by complementary goodies.

A well‑presented hamper feels like a gift from a high‑end boutique rather than a mass‑produced corporate souvenir.

Logistics and Timing: Delivering Luxury on Schedule

Timing is everything in corporate gifting. A hamper that arrives late or damaged can tarnish an otherwise brilliant gesture.

image

    Lead Time: Order at least 2–3 weeks before the event to account for sourcing and packaging. Delivery Tracking: Choose a courier that offers real‑time tracking and guaranteed delivery dates. Climate Control: For truffle‑heavy hampers, ensure the shipment stays within optimal temperature ranges to preserve aroma.
